John Mosier v Thomas Simpson (2001)

A car driver was executing a three-point turn beyond a sharp bend in the road.

A speeding motorcyclist came around the bend and was faced with car blocking his side of the carriageway. A collision occurred.

Driver 60% to blame          Motorcyclist 40% to blame
